A CHINESE BLUE AND WHITE MOULDED 'CAMELLIA' BOWL

KANGXI 1662-1722

Shaped as a flowerhead, the fluted U-shaped body painted to the exterior with panels of birds perched amidst camellia, the well decorated with a roundel enclosing the same design, with a ding mark to the base, 21.9cm.

Cf. Musée Ariana, Geneva, for the pair to this bowl.
